First Get a MRI knee joint done, if not already done to find out which ligament is injured. Treatment depends on the ligament injured and severity of injury.

Visit a physiotherapist, you need to take electrotherapy for few days may be and then some exercises. Also, taping or compression with crepe bandage may be required.
